Unearth the Stories of Virginia: A Journey Through Time and Nature

Discover the Virginia Museum of History & Culture in Richmond, a vibrant cultural gem nestled downtown. This captivating destination showcases Virginia's rich heritage through engaging exhibits, captivating artifacts, and a vast library. Explore immersive displays that celebrate the state's diverse stories, from the colonial era to modern times. Surrounding gardens and monuments enhance the experience, inviting reflection and tranquility. Perfect for history buffs and casual visitors alike, the museum is a gateway to understanding Virginia's culture and history, making it a must-visit stop in the charming Museum District. Things to do near Virginia Museum of History & Culture

The Virginia Museum of History & Culture invites travelers to explore its rich exhibitions and guided tours, showcasing the state's vibrant past. Nestled in a scenic area with lush gardens and parks, visitors can enjoy outdoor activities like biking and hiking before diving into the intriguing stories within the museum's walls.

  • Maymont ParkOpens in a new window – Stroll through the lush landscapes of Maymont Park, a splendid private garden that invites you to explore its vibrant flowers and serene pathways. This beautiful space features meticulously designed gardens, a historic estate, and captivating wildlife exhibits that make it a delightful escape. Whether you’re enjoying a quiet picnic or admiring the ornamental plants, Maymont offers a perfect blend of nature and history.
  • CarytownOpens in a new window – Discover the eclectic charm of Carytown, a lively neighborhood filled with unique shops, local eateries, and artistic flair. This vibrant area is ideal for a leisurely day of window shopping and tasting delicious food from various cuisines. With its colorful storefronts and friendly atmosphere, Carytown is a hub of creativity and community, making it a great spot to unwind and soak in the local culture.
